Comprehending Window Handle Covers

Window handle covers, frequently made from plastic or metal, protect the internal mechanisms of window handles. Affordable Window Handle Replacement can be discovered on various window types, consisting of casement, sliding, and awning windows. A properly maintained handle cover not only enhances your window's look however also serves to prevent dust and wetness build-up, which can cause deterioration and dysfunction.

Indications It's Time for Replacement

Here are some dead giveaways that may suggest it's time to replace your window handle covers:

  • Visible cracks or chips in the cover
  • Handle cover feels loose and moves freely
  • Staining or fading of the cover's finish
  • Difficulty in operating the window handle

Replacement Steps

  1. Examine the Situation: Begin by inspecting the current window handle cover to figure out if a replacement is required.
  2. Collect Tools: Ensure you have the needed tools and replacement parts ready. Having everything on hand will simplify the process.
  3. Get Rid Of the Old Handle Cover: Using a screwdriver, carefully eliminate any screws holding the handle in location. Thoroughly remove the handle cover from the window.
  4. Examine the Handle Mechanism: With the cover eliminated, take a minute to inspect the handle mechanism for any additional wear or damage.
  5. Tidy the Area: Use a cleansing cloth to wipe down any dust and debris around the handle area.
  6. Apply Lubricant (if essential): If you come across rust or tightness, apply a percentage of lubricant to the handle mechanism for smooth operation.
  7. Set Up the New Handle Cover: Position the new handle cover over the system and align it with the screw holes. Secure it in place with screws.
  8. Test Functionality: After installation, test the handle to ensure it moves easily and opens and closes the window with no concerns.
  9. Final Inspection: Give your work one last seek to guarantee everything is tight and secure.

Upkeep Tips for Window Handle Covers

To extend the life-span of your new window handle cover, consider the following upkeep ideas: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Dust and clean the handle covers to prevent discoloration. Use a moderate cleansing solution suitable for the product of your handle cover.
  2. Routine Checks: At least twice a year, examine the condition of your handle covers for indications of wear or damage.
  3. Lube Moving Parts: If the handle feels stiff, apply a small amount of lubricant when in a while.
  4. Avoid Over-Tightening: When securing the cover, do not over-tighten screws, as this can harm the cover.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How typically should I replace my window handle covers?

Window handle covers should be examined regularly, and any signs of wear or damage ought to prompt a replacement. Usually, they can last several years if correctly kept.

2. Can I replace the handle cover myself?

Yes, changing a window handle cover is a DIY job that the majority of homeowners can manage with fundamental tools and a little time.

3. What should I search for when purchasing a replacement handle cover?

When purchasing a brand-new handle cover, guarantee it works with your window's model, matches your home's visual, and is made from durable materials.

4. Will changing the window handle cover improve window security?

While a handle cover itself does not straight improve security, ensuring it remains in good condition can assist maintain the integrity of the window system, which is vital for total security.

5. How much does a window handle cover replacement cost?

The cost varies depending upon the type and product of the handle cover but generally varies from ₤ 10 to ₤ 50. Professional installation will sustain additional costs.
